Improving communicative practices will reduce the massive rate and cost of medication errors and hospital-acquired infections. Current costs of hospital-caused incidents are around AU$2 billion per year. These costs are likely to rise further because hospitals are becoming busier, more culturally and linguistically diverse, less generously resourced per patient, and more technologically capable of keeping sicker patients alive for longer, leading to increased clinical risk and more incidents. This project could save around 20% of the total cost of hospital operations by reducing lengths of stay, lowering re-admission rates and ensuring better deployment of clinical resources.Read moreRead less

This project focuses on the measurement and development of lead ....Developing leadership for high stress workplaces: Improving well-being, engagement, productivity and staff retention. Workplaces today are increasingly complex. The ageing of the workforce, growing economic pressure and increasing employee mobility make the ability of organisations to attract, develop and retain talented staff critical issues for Australian industry. Staff stress costs the economy tens of billions of dollars a year. This project focuses on the measurement and development of leader's ability to take sophisticated perspectives on complex events, and in so doing open new possibilities for effective action. By developing models, tools and training methods to enhance this ability in managers, we aim to make an important contribution economic sustainability and employee well-being in Australia and internationally.Read moreRead less
